What's the difference between Mission Without Borders Operation Christmas Love boxes and others?
Mission Without Borders sources the contents of every box locally in the country it will be distributed. This is important because it ensures families receive items that they are familiar with and cook with regularly. Operation Christmas Love boxes are also packed and delivered by local staff and volunteers in the countries we serve. Not only does this help develop stronger relationships with the families we work with, it allows us to save expensive international shipping costs and ensure your donation has the largest impact possible.
Not only does each Operation Christmas Love Box come packed with material supplies, it also opens the door for our coordinators to developing relationships with families and invite them to explore their local church community.
Poverty in Eastern Europe is real
Europe isn't usually the first place that comes to mind when thinking in about those in need. Often we think of Europe as a vacation destination and a place of abundance. However, poverty is real in Eastern Europe. Countries still struggling with the past oppression of communism have some of the largest wealth gaps between the haves and have-nots.
So many families we serve in Albania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Bulgaria, Moldova, Romania, and Ukraine are struggling in deep poverty.
